The refinery covers a total area of 440,000 square meters. It is linked to an oil jetty at the Port of Tema by pipelines of various diameters for the transportation of crude oil and refined petroleum products. TOR's refining plant was designed in 1963 as a Hydro-skimming plant with an initial capacity of 28,000 barrels per stream day.

- Where is the oil refinery located in Ghana?
- A US$1.98 billion oil refinery facility at Tema, Ghana is scheduled to commence operation by end of August this year. The refinery, which is the latest investment of the Sentuo Group, is expected to produce five million metric tonnes of petroleum products including liquified petroleum gas (LPG), jet fuel, gasoline, diesel and fuel oil.
- Who built Ghana's first oil refinery?
- Tema, Jan. 26, GNA- President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o on Friday commissioned Ghana’s first private oil refinery built by the Sentuo Group, Ghana, a Chinese conglomerate, at the Tema Industrial Area, near Accra.
- Who owns the Ghanaian oil refinery?
- The refinery was first named the Ghanaian Italian Petroleum Company (GHAIP). It was licensed as a private limited liability company in 1960 as a fully owned Italian company – ANIC Societa per Azioni and AGIP Societa per Azioni of Italy were its major shareholders. In April 1977, the Government of Ghana became the sole shareholder.
